Illustrative photo for: Copper steadied near record high as Trump rejects Iran

Published 2026-05-12

Summary: Copper steadied near its near-record levels as traders weighed Middle East tensions after Trump rejected Iran’s peace proposals and described the ceasefire with Tehran as being on “life support.” The metal traded around $5.6 per pound, holding within a sideways range as activity cooled from recent moves.

Context

Copper is widely watched as a gauge of global economic activity and risk appetite. Political shocks and geopolitical tensions can influence supply expectations, demand outlooks, and risk sentiment in commodity markets. In recent weeks, attention has focused on U.S.–Iran relations and potential impacts on energy and shipping routes that can, in turn, affect copper and broader metals markets.

Why It Matters

Near-record copper levels can signal strong demand expectations and tight supply dynamics, but they can also reflect heightened risk premiums tied to geopolitical developments. Traders and investors monitor such headlines for potential shifts in global growth forecasts and inflation implications.
